Moxica Cv Dosage & How to Take

This is the usual dosage recommended in most common treatment cases. Please remember that every patient and their case is different, so the dosage can be different based on the disease, route of administration, patient's age and medical history.

Find the right dosage based on disease and age

Age Group Dosage
13 - 18 years (Adolescent)
  • Disease: Sinusitis
  • Before or After Meal: Either
  • Single Maximum Dose: 1000 mg
  • Dosage Form: Tablet
  • Dosage Route: Oral
  • Frequency: 12 hourly
  • Course Duration: 2 weeks
  • Special Instructions: strength 875 mg amoxicillin and 125 mg clavulanic acid

Moxica Cv Related Warnings

  • Is the use of Moxica Cv safe for pregnant women?


    Pregnant women can take Moxica CV safely.

    Safe
  • Is the use of Moxica Cv safe during breastfeeding?


    Moxica CV does not show any side effects in breastfeeding women.

    Safe
  • What is the effect of Moxica Cv on the Kidneys?


    Kidney can be affected by Moxica CV. If you experience any unwanted effects of this drug, stop taking it. You should take it again only after medical advice.

    Moderate
  • What is the effect of Moxica Cv on the Liver?


    The liver can be affected by Moxica CV. If you experience any unwanted effects of this drug, stop taking it and consult your doctor. You should restart Moxica CV only after medical advice.

    Moderate
  • What is the effect of Moxica Cv on the Heart?


    Moxica CV is rarely harmful for the heart.

    Mild

Question over 5 years ago

What is Moxica CV?

ravi udawat MBBS , General Physician

Moxica CV is a brand name for amoxicillin. It is a prescription drug that belongs to the class of medications called penicillin antibiotic. It is used in the treatment of the number of bacterial infections such as tonsillitis, pneumonia, bronchitis, gonorrhea, and infection of ear, nose, throat, skin, urinary tract. It is also used in combination with other antibiotic medications such as clarithromycin to treat stomach ulcer caused by Helicobacter pylori bacteria.
